Alexandra is an associate in Freshfields’ dispute resolution practice in Washington, DC.
Prior to joining Freshfields, Alexandra worked as a summer associate for the Groom Law Group where she handled Department of Labor subpoenas, as well as regulatory matters pertaining to ERISA and the ACA. Alexandra also worked as a law clerk for the Honorable Rudolph Contreras in the United States District Court for the District of Columbia, where she conducted legal research and drafted opinions. Alexandra previously worked for Freshfields as a summer associate, where she focused on international arbitration and sanctions matters and was an avid member of the pro-bono department.
Alexandra received her J.D. from University of Pennsylvania Carey Law School, where she was Senior Editor of the University of Pennsylvania Journal of Constitutional Law and an associate editor on The Regulatory Review. Alexandra is a Fulbright Scholar, holds her master’s degree in education and child development from the University of Oxford, and has an MBA from The Wharton School.
